Abstract
"ARRANJO PARA MEDIçãO DE FLUIDOS, POR EXEMPLO, PARA PLANTAS TêXTEIS". A presente invenção refere-se a um sistema para a medição seletiva de fluidos, por exemplo, para a medição de fluidos em plantas têxteis, compreende: - um coletor (12) que compreende pelo menos uma válvula (12.1, ..., 12.n), a qual pode seletivamente prover uma conexão para uma respectiva linha de suprimento (22.1, .... 22.n) para um fluido a ser medido; e - um dispositivo de medição tipo de seringa (20) conectado ao referido coletor (12), de modo que, com a válvula mencionada anteriormente (12.1, .... 12.n) que coloca o coletor (12) em conexão com a respectiva linha de suprimento (22.1, .... 22.n), o elemento de medição tipo de seringa sendo capaz de lembrar no coletor (12) uma quantidade do fluido a ser medida, identificada peia posição de medição atingida pelo elemento de medição tipo de seringa (20) em uma relação de comunicação de fluido com o coletor (12).
